I have this problem, where if I try to put any large movies on my N95 8GB under "My Videos" folder, it crashes Video Centre everytime I open it. If I move the movie out of that folder, Video Centre is fine. I tried 200MB files, such as TV series and Video Centre plays it ok.
The large movie file itself does play in Real Player if I just browse to it and play, or if I play it through Gallery.
It seems like the size of the file is the problem, but I know someone who has played 800MB file in Video Centre and his one is fine, plus, the Spiderman movie played ok (That's gone now as I upgraded the firmware).
I have performed hard reset, soft reset, re-formatted the flash disk, basically had it with all original settings with nothing on the phone, and it still doesn't work.
Can anyone help, or shed some light on this, as this is really annoying me. I only bought the phone 10days ago, so if there's something wrong with the flash drive I would like to return the phone. However, I do doubt that as the movie plays fine outside that folder.

I'm on a generic firmware and it's happening on mine, I have figured out that if you attempt to play over and over again, i.e. just keep going back into Video Centre, it eventually plays. However, thats not a solution, hardly even a work around, considering everytime you add another movie, you going have to do the same again.
It's definately having trouble loading refreshing it's list of movies.

Well i don't have this problem and i have two films one is Resident Evil @502mb and also Kill Bill 2 @659mb both in the My Videos folder and they both play from the Video Centre without any problems.
They are both converted using Movavi Video Converter with the iPod 320x240 MP4 settings and the quality and sound is excellent, what setting have you converted yours to? although the fact you still play them from elsewhere doesn't really make any sense that the there is a problem with the files.
